Newer
Older
KaiFengPC / src / api / project / recordsReward.js
@鲁yixuan 鲁yixuan 5 hours ago 1 KB updata
import request from '@/utils/request';

// 搜索我创建的施工许可
export function getProjectCompletionAcceptanceMyPage(params) {
  return request({
    url: '/business/projectBonusNoticeRecord/myPage',
    method: 'get',
    params,
  });
}

// 分页搜索项目规划许可
export function getProjectCompletionAcceptancePage(params) {
  return request({
    url: '/business/projectBonusNoticeRecord/page',
    method: 'get',
    params,
  });
}

// 新增项目竣工验收
export function projectCompletionAcceptanceeAdd(data) {
  return request({
    url: '/business/projectBonusNoticeRecord/add',
    method: 'post',
    data,
  });
}

// 修改项目竣工验收
export function projectCompletionAcceptanceeEdit(data) {
  return request({
    url: '/business/projectBonusNoticeRecord/edit',
    method: 'put',
    data,
  });
}

// 发起竣工验收工作流
export function projectCompletionAcceptanceeStartWorkFlow(data) {
  return request({
    url: '/business/projectBonusNoticeRecord/startWorkFlow',
    method: 'post',
    data,
  });
}

// 详细搜索项目竣工验收
export function projectCompletionAcceptanceeDetail(id) {
  return request({
    url: `/business/projectBonusNoticeRecord/${id}`,
    method: 'get',
  });
}

// 详细搜索项目竣工验收
export function projectCompletionAcceptanceeDel(ids) {
  return request({
    url: `/business/projectBonusNoticeRecord/${ids}`,
    method: 'delete',
  });
}

// 验收审查
export function projectCompletionAcceptanceApprove(data) {
  return request({
    url: '/business/projectBonusNoticeRecord/approve',
    method: 'post',
    data,
  });
}

// 列表搜索项目奖补须知
export function projectBonusNoticeList() {
  return request({
    url: `/business/projectBonusNotice/list`,
    method: 'get',
  });
}